English
Etymology
From Latin Numidia , from Numida + -ia , from an earlier interpretation of Ancient Greek Νομάς ( Nomás ) (genitive Νομάδος ( Nomádos ) ). Compare Latin Nomas , whence English nomad .
Pronunciation
Proper noun
Numidia
( historical ) A historical region and ancient Berber kingdom located in North Africa , initially situated in modern Algeria but later expanding into Tunisia and Libya .
1621 , Robert Burton, The Anatomy of Melancholy :Massinissa made many inward parts of Barbarie and Numidia in Africk (before his time incult and horrid) fruitful and battable by this means.
( historical ) A former province of the Roman Empire , approximately located in modern northeastern Algeria .
( rare ) A female given name .
